Google AI Model Impacts Facebook's Machine Learning Strategy
The arrival of Google ’s new AI model has undoubtedly posed a significant challenge to Meta’s trajectory in the competitive AI landscape. Previously, Meta had been aggressively pioneering on its own large language models, including Llama, positioning itself as a key player in the generative AI space. However, the model’s demonstrably superior performance across a range of benchmarks, especially in areas like complex problem-solving, now compels Meta to adjust its approach. This may mean accelerating its own model development, exploring different architectural designs, or potentially shifting its overall AI strategy to better differentiate itself against Google's substantial influence.
